网上商城mysql 数据库 深入学习JAVA程序
【网上商城MySQL数据库深入学习JAVA程序】是一个针对Java开发人员和学生的学习资源,它提供了完整的网上商城项目的源代码,以及相关的毕业设计论文和设计流程。这个项目旨在帮助那些正在自学Java编程,特别是对数据库和Web应用程序开发感兴趣的人。通过这个项目,你可以深入了解如何使用Java技术和MySQL数据库来构建一个功能完善的网上购物平台。 我们要讨论的是Java编程语言。Java是一种跨平台、面向对象的编程语言,被广泛应用于Web应用开发。在这个项目中,你将接触到Java的核心概念,如类、对象、接口、异常处理、多线程等,同时还会涉及到Servlet和JSP(JavaServer Pages)技术,它们是用于构建动态网页的关键工具。 MySQL数据库是该项目的重要组成部分。MySQL是一个开源的关系型数据库管理系统,以其高效、稳定和易于使用而著名。在设计网上商城时,你需要理解如何创建数据库模式,定义数据表,以及使用SQL(Structured Query Language)进行数据的增删改查操作。此外,你还将学习到如何在Java代码中与数据库进行交互,比如使用JDBC(Java Database Connectivity)API。 项目中提到的整体设计流程涵盖了软件开发生命周期的各个阶段,包括需求分析、系统设计、编码实现、测试和维护。你需要了解每个阶段的目标和任务,以便有效地组织你的工作。需求分析涉及理解网上商城的功能需求和用户需求;系统设计则包括架构设计、数据库设计和模块划分;编码实现是将设计转化为实际代码;测试确保软件的质量和性能;最后的维护阶段则关注软件的更新和改进。 文件名为"bookstore",这可能是指项目的主模块或者数据库中的一个关键表,如“书店”或“商品目录”。你将学习如何管理商品信息,处理用户的订单,以及实现购物车功能等。此外,还可能涉及到用户注册、登录、评论、评价等功能,这些都是网上商城系统不可或缺的部分。 在实际操作过程中,你还会遇到诸如安全性、性能优化、错误处理等问题。例如,你可能需要了解如何防止SQL注入,优化查询速度,以及处理并发访问。同时,良好的代码结构和注释对于理解和维护项目至关重要,这也是项目开发中的重要技巧。 这个网上商城项目提供了一个实践和学习Java Web开发的绝佳平台。通过它,你可以深化对Java和MySQL的理解,掌握实际项目开发经验,从而提高自己的编程技能和问题解决能力。对于想要从事软件开发,尤其是电子商务领域的人来说,这是一个非常有价值的学习资源。
- 1
- 2
- 花开相思豆2014-06-24代码有点问题
- zhangjq2013-06-20是网上书店怎么冠名网上商城,而且我也没看到数据库啊
- jiangnanmengxue2015-04-25很nice的学习资料
- 粉丝: 132
- 资源: 21
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助